Transaction cdb91d20af16be494f2f562540ce0f3249f3c8473565ced711e2d2db7d7ecc8e
1 Input
2 Outputs
- cdb91d20af16be494f2f562540ce0f3249f3c8473565ced711e2d2db7d7ecc8e:0
- cdb91d20af16be494f2f562540ce0f3249f3c8473565ced711e2d2db7d7ecc8e:1
value 17372847
address 2NBzWFKxUtwHjEfHd7xxHvUG5TM9N8K25FX
value 2000000
address mrANYtfkACnQqczk5Kdv1ZtgRTR1JsxDbV